Regulatory and legal factors significantly impact the water treatment chemicals market. Various governmental bodies establish guidelines to ensure environmental safety, public health, and compliance with industry standards. Regulations like the Clean Water Act in the United States and the EU Water Framework Directive dictate permissible levels of contaminants and the efficacy of treatment chemicals. Companies must adhere to strict safety protocols and undergo rigorous testing to validate the performance and environmental impact of their products. Furthermore, emerging regulations around water quality and chemical usage are pushing manufacturers toward more sustainable practices. Institutions are increasingly focusing on minimizing the ecological footprint of chemical treatments, driving innovation towards biodegradable or less harmful alternatives, making regulatory compliance essential for market success.

Water treatment chemicals and technology are essential across various sectors. In municipal systems, they ensure safe drinking water by removing contaminants. In power generation, they prevent scale and corrosion in cooling systems. Chemical industries rely on water treatment for process optimization and waste management. The food and beverage sector uses these technologies to maintain hygiene and product quality. In the pulp and paper industry, they manage wastewater and enhance bleaching processes. Water treatment chemicals include coagulants and flocculants that facilitate particle removal by aggregating impurities, enhancing clarity and safety. Corrosion and scale inhibitors prevent damage in pipes and equipment, extending lifespan and reducing maintenance costs. Antifoamants and defoamers mitigate foam formation, ensuring efficient processing. Biocides control microbial growth, safeguarding water quality. Activated carbon adsorbs organic compounds and pollutants, improving taste and safety. Collectively, these chemicals boost the demand for water treatment technologies by ensuring effective treatment, regulatory compliance, and operational efficiency, essential for industries and municipalities in managing water resources sustainably.
